3 Gulf War Iraq needed money so they invaded Kuwait. The United Nations did not like this. The United Nations bombed Iraq and then a month later they ground-attacked them and retook possession of Kuwait. Rwanda In Rwanda there was an ethnic conflict between the Hutu and the Tutsi. Due to this conflict 500,000 died. Bosnian War In Yugoslavia ethnic conflict occurred here as well between the Serbs, Croats and Muslims. Yugoslavia was eventually broken up. Struggles for power and control between the ethnic groups led to ethnic cleansing (population transfer).

4 Events/News Feb. 26, 1993 in New York City a bomb exploded in the basement garage of the World Trade Center, killing 6 and injuring at least 1,040 others. The North American Free Trade Agreement (NAFTA) gets signed by the governments of the United States, Canada, and Mexico and came into play on January 1, 1994. The 90's saw a world wide increase of the use, production, and smuggling of the drug trade, with the drugs becoming more addictive and destructive

5 There was an increase in Aids in Africa and throughout the world. O. J. Simpson got arrested in killings of wife, Nicole Brown Simpson, and friend, Ronald Goldman June 18, 1994. On April 19, 1995 in Oklahoma City a car bomb exploded outside the federal office building. 168 people were killed, including 19 children and 1 person who died in rescue effort. Over 220 buildings were damaged. Bill Clinton becomes 42 president of the United States on January 20, 1993.

6  If you have $100 Converted from 1990 to 2005 it would be equivalent to $153.76 today.  In 1990 the average income per year was $28,970.00.

7  Snowboard $199.00  Microwave $269.00.  Potatoes were $1.99 for 10 lbs.  Lazy Boy Recliner $260.00.  Bike $60.00

8  In the nineties, the fashion was casual and comfortable.  Overalls, flannel shirts, neon color clothing, leather jackets, baggy jeans, and baby doll shirts were very popular.  Bell button piercing became very popular during this era.

9  In 1990 a new house cost $123,000.00 and by 1999 was $131,700.00.  If you were to buy a house in Pennsylvania it would cost you $89,100.00.

10  1990 Ford Mustang Convertible $14,289.00  Average car cost was $16,000.00

11 In 1990 a gallon of gas was $1.34 By 1999 gas dropped to $1.22

12  The 1990s best known for teen pop and electronic dance music, and for being the decade of hip hop and alternative rock.  Some artist include:  Janet Jackson  Bon Jovi  Aerosmith  Red Hot Chili Peppers  Vanilla Ice  Billy Joel  Phil Collins  Billy Idol  And many others as well

13  Some 1990 fads included Pokémon, push pops, pogs, clackers, spandex shorts, tamagotchi, and the Macarena.

14  Home Alone (1990)  Beauty and the Beast (1991)  Beethoven (1992)  Aladdin (1992)  Batman Returns(1992)  Jurassic Park (1993)  Forrest Gump (1994)  Jumanji (1995)  Edward Scissorhands (1990)

15  Many TV. shows were big in the 1990’s.  Rugrats were a big TV. show for children.  Other included Law & Order, Power Rangers, and The Fresh Prince of Bel Air.

16  TV show sitcoms were popular with the American audience.  A popular notable video game of 1990 was Super Mario World.  American NBA Basketball player Michael Jordan becomes a major sports and pop culture icon idolized by millions worldwide.  The Rachel, Jennifer Aniston's hairstyle on the hit show Friends, became popular with millions of women copying it worldwide.

17  The world wide web was founded on November 12th, 1990.  In 1995 Ken Kutaragi introduced us to the first Play Station.  In 1993 James Dyson created the first bag less vacuum cleaner.  The DVD was developed and invented by Sony, and Philips in 1995.

18  The World Wide Web was invented in 1990 by Tim Berners-Lee.  A sheep later called Dolly was cloned from the cell of an adult Ewe (sheep) and was fused with an unfertilized egg cell from which the nucleic DNA had been removed.  The V-chip was invented used for television receivers allowing the blocking of programs based on their ratings category.

19  There were many popular toys in the 1990’s.  Some in which included Silly Putty, Polly Pocket, Moon Shoes, Pillow Pals, G.I. Joe, Bop it, Game Boy and many others.
